Final answer:
The horizontal component of the velocity of a soccer ball kicked at a speed of 15 m/s and an angle of 10 degrees is approximately 14.8 m/s.
Step-by-step explanation:
To find the horizontal component of the velocity, we can use the formula:
Horizontal component of velocity = initial velocity * cos(angle)
Given that the initial velocity is 15 m/s and the angle is 10 degrees, we can plug these values into the formula:
Horizontal component of velocity = 15 m/s * cos(10 degrees)
Using a scientific calculator, we find that the horizontal component of velocity is approximately 14.8 m/s.
